  • Descriptive Accuracy

    Anatomical terminology must accurately describe the liver’s location, shape, size, and relationships to adjacent structures. Translations should capture these descriptive aspects effectively. For instance, describing the liver’s position “en el cuadrante superior derecho del abdomen” (in the upper right quadrant of the abdomen) requires a clear understanding of spatial relationships and anatomical context, reflecting the same information conveyed in English.

  • Pathological Descriptions

    The development of diseases affecting the liver requires specialized terminology to describe the observed pathologies. Terms like “hepatomegalia” (liver enlargement), “cirrosis” (cirrhosis), or “esteatosis heptica” (fatty liver disease) need to be accurately conveyed and understood in Spanish to facilitate diagnosis, treatment, and research. Inconsistent translation can impede the accurate communication of diagnostic findings and treatment plans.

The demand for precise medical translation extends beyond the basic anatomical term. Conditions such as “hepatitis,” “cirrhosis,” and “hepatocellular carcinoma” require equally accurate Spanish translations (“hepatitis,” “cirrosis,” and “carcinoma hepatocelular,” respectively). Furthermore, accurate conversion of medical instructions, dosage information for liver-related medications, and informed consent documents is essential for patients who primarily speak Spanish.   • Ingredient Identification

    Liver, under its Spanish translation “hgado,” functions as a specific ingredient in numerous dishes worldwide. Its identification in recipes, whether in Spanish-speaking regions or when translating recipes for a Spanish-speaking audience, requires accurate translation. For example, recipes may specify “hgado de res” (beef liver), “hgado de pollo” (chicken liver), or “hgado de cerdo” (pork liver). Incorrect identification could lead to the use of the wrong ingredient, significantly altering the dish’s flavor profile and nutritional content.

  • Recipe Interpretation

    Understanding recipes that use “hgado” involves interpreting cooking instructions and preparation techniques accurately. Recipes often specify how the liver should be prepared, such as “hgado encebollado” (liver with onions) or “pt de hgado” (liver pat). The translation must convey not only the ingredient but also the method of preparation. Misinterpretation of these instructions can result in a dish that is not prepared correctly or does not meet the intended taste and texture.
